Output 3076f54de5be221927fc3128b74348d9a758e745aa56fa098203002df670f30c:0

value
32417907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65bd9c253572a4550d45e092035455e7b9d100d4 OP_EQUAL
address
MHB7d8msXLMfMoMeV1pLCxKTtKiVpT9EQX
transaction
3076f54de5be221927fc3128b74348d9a758e745aa56fa098203002df670f30c
spent
true